> > I found that the existing `test03` function in
> > `libstdc++-v3/src/c++11/system_error.cc`, used for testing
> > `std::system_error_category.message(int)`, doesn't work correctly in
> > non-English language environments. This is likely because neither
> > `std::locale` nor `std::setlocale` affects the language of the error
> > message obtained by `FormatMessage()`.
>
> We pass LANG_USER_DEFAULT to FormatMessage, but I don't think that is
> related in any way to the C locale.
>
> I think the testcase could use SetThreadPreferredUILanguages to set
> en-US as the language that will be used by FormatMessage.
>
> > Furthermore, in non-English
> > environments, such as Chinese, system error messages end with "."\r\n"
> > instead of ".\r\n", which prevents `__builtin_memcmp(buf + len - 3,
> > ".\r\n", 3) {in libstdc++-v3\src\c++11\system_error.cc:178}` from
> > correctly removing the trailing "\r\n".
>
> Let's do this instead:
>
>     if (len > 2 && !__builtin_memcmp(buf + len - 2, "\r\n", 2)) [[likely]]
>       len -= 2 + (buf[len - 1] == '.');
                         ^
Is buf[len - 1] == '.' always false here?
